K-Drama-Inspired Folded Tuna Kimbap Recipe for Bento Lunches
Folded tuna kimbap gained attention in the K-drama Extraordinary Attorney Woo, where it offered a quicker way to enjoy the Korean rice roll. Instead of rolling with a bamboo mat, the nori sheet folds into sections that hold the fillings together. It’s a practical option for meal preppers and bento lunches because it’s easy to assemble and pack.
